Ī previously unreleased version performed by The Beatles (for the BBC radio show Pop Go the Beatles broadcast on June 11, 1963) is included on their album Live at the BBC, released in 1994. It is one of twelve songs recorded by them in July 1962 on a tape, which was re-purchased by Paul McCartney at a Sotheby's auction in 1985. The Beatles played "Young Blood" in their Cavern Club repertoire. The song was included in the musical revue Smokey Joe's Cafe. The Coasters' version is ranked #414 on Rolling Stone's list of the 500 Greatest Songs of All Time, the group's only song on the list. It topped Billboard's R&B chart and reached #8 on the Billboard Hot 100. Their version can also be heard on The Very Best of the Coasters album. "Young Blood" was originally recorded by The Coasters and released as a single together with " Searchin'" in March 1957 by Atco Records (#6087). The lyrical theme is one typical of early rock and roll: boy meets girl, then meets girl's father, who does not approve of boy so the boy departs, but cannot stop thinking about the girl, declaring "You're the one, you're the one, you're the one." Musically, the song follows a minor blues structure, built mostly around three chords (i7, iv7, V7) except for the bridge (IV, VI, III, V).
